Your Bill of Materials (BOM) is more than just a list—it’s the foundation of your production planning. For straightforward products, a single-level BOM might suffice. But as your business grows and you produce more complex items with multiple subassemblies, a simple list won’t cut it.
That’s where a multi-level (or indented) BOM comes in. It doesn’t just show components—it maps out the relationships between parts, subassemblies, and final products. Yes, these BOMs are more intricate, but the payoff is worth it. They offer valuable insights that lead to smarter production plans, optimized inventory levels, and smoother supply chains.
When integrated with your inventory management or ERP system, a multi-level BOM becomes a game changer. You’ll plan capacities more accurately, avoid bottlenecks, and boost production efficiency. In short, it’s the tool that can help you scale your operations while staying lean and responsive.
What’s in this blog?
- What is a multi-level BOM?
- Importance of multi-level BOM in supply chain and capacity planning
- Key benefits of multi-level BOM for supply chain efficiency
- Challenges in managing multi-level BOMs
- Case Study: Eastern Warehouse Distribution reduced inventory value by 40%
- Best practices for managing multi-level BOMs
- Leveraging Netstock for BOM management and capacity planning
- Simplifying production with multi-level BOMs
1. What is a multi-level BOM?
A multi-level BOM is a hierarchy of parts, showing relationships between the finished product and subassemblies in a family tree relationship. A single-level BOM lists all parts on the same level, whereas a multi-level BOM shows the parts under the sub-assemblies to which they belong. It shows multiple layers of dependencies, illustrating how they fit together to form subassemblies and assemblies.
A multi-level BOM is particularly useful in industries producing complex products like machines, appliances, and vehicles.
Multi-level BOMs comprise the following key components:
- Hierarchies: Show the parent-child relationship between parts, subassemblies, and finished products.
- Part numbers: Every part must have a unique number that differentiates it from all others. The part number ensures easy tracking through production.
- Descriptions: Clear, detailed descriptions reduce confusion.
- Quantities: Accurate quantities needed to produce each production unit enable accurate planning and resource allocation.
- Dependency levels: Every level of the BOM must show how parts make up the subassemblies and combine to create the finished product.
2. Importance of multi-level BOM in supply chain and capacity planning
The multi-level BOM provides a hierarchical plan of how complex products go together. It is a blueprint for planning supply chain actions and capacity utilization. It helps businesses plan workflows and ensures that materials arrive lineside as they are needed in the process.
Multi-level BOMs are helpful for the following reasons:
- Improved visibility and traceability: Organizations can use the BOMs to understand relationships between components to ensure efficient material flow and prevent production delays. Planners can trace the components from procurement to assembly as they understand the dependencies in complex structures.
- Integrated capacity planning: Multi-level BOMs support capacity planning with forecasts of material requirements, resulting in work center loading and resource requirements. The BOMs allow planners to work out exact material resource requirements. They can allocate machinery, labor, and production time and balance workloads. They can identify dependencies to detect bottlenecks and plan smooth production.
Modern demand and supply planning platforms like Netstock can integrate with planning software and BOMs to automate demand forecasting and help plan procurement based on production schedules and capacity planning.
3. Key benefits of multi-level BOM for supply chain efficiency
Multi-level BOMs bring a range of benefits that help drive supply chain efficiency, including:
- Streamline manufacturing processes: Multi-level BOMs allow planners to develop production schedules with smooth workflows to avoid downtime. Precise quantities ensure the proper inventory is delivered to the production line to prevent excess stock and material shortages. Procurement has the information to order materials and components in time to honor lead times.
- Risk management: Component dependencies reveal vulnerabilities, like reliance on sole suppliers or long lead times that could delay production. Businesses can map dependencies to identify bottlenecks and plan to overcome them before they become a reality. Better visibility means managers can identify risks and possible delays and act before disrupting production.
- Cross-departmental collaboration: Multi-level BOMs are a shared resource used by Engineering, Procurement, and Production teams. A single reference tool facilitates communication and helps to eliminate errors and misunderstandings.
4. Challenges in managing multi-level BOMs
Multi-level BOMs are complex documents and can present challenges such as:
- Data Complexity and overload: Multi-level BOMs contain vast amounts of data, especially where products have intricate designs and many subassemblies. Data volume management, especially with frequent product revisions, can lead to errors if not adequately controlled. This can lead to component shortages or excess stocks if parts or incorrect quantities are missing on the BOMs.
- Version control and change management: Outdated or inaccurate BOMs can lead to production errors and material shortages. The BOMs must be centralized to ensure all teams work with the same version. Even small BOM changes can only impact production if the change is adequately communicated to all parties.
- Integration with ERP/MRP systems: Accurate and up-to-date BOM information must be seamlessly integrated with the ERP and MRP systems. Without integration, there will be miscommunications between departments. Without an integrated system, teams must manually update ERP systems, and errors can creep in.
5. Case Study: Eastern Warehouse Distribution reduced inventory value by 40%
Eastern Warehouse Distributors (EWD) has been a trusted name in the automotive aftermarket since 1989. With 41 warehouses across the state, managing inventory was becoming more of a challenge. Their manual system offered limited visibility, leading to long lead times, stock-outs, and excess stock caused by spreadsheet errors.
To tackle these issues, EWD brought in Netstock and integrated it with their custom ERP system. The results speak for themselves:
Key results:
- Time savings: Managing purchase orders became much quicker, freeing up time for the team to focus on other tasks.
- Excess stock reduction: Inventory value dropped from $3 million to $1.8 million, and excess stock went from $68,000 down to just $1,600—releasing much-needed capital.
- Improved supplier relationships: Better forecasts and staggered deliveries helped improve reliability and strengthen relationships with suppliers.
By moving from manual processes to automated, data-driven inventory management, EWD has made inventory planning easier and more efficient.
6. Best practices for managing multi-level BOMs
- Standardization of BOM structures: Standardizing BOM formats across departments improves communication and reduces errors. A unified structure ensures clear hierarchies, part descriptions, and quantities, improving.
- Real-Time updates and collaboration: Real-time updates and collaborative tools within BOM management software work well. They ensure all stakeholders use the latest data, so there is less risk they will work with outdated or incorrect information.
- Technology integration: Integrating multi-level BOMs with inventory management and capacity planning tools, systems like Netstock optimize material requirements, lead times, and procurement planning. Integration improves visibility, enables better forecasting, and supports smoother workflows. Supply chain and production efficiency will improve.
7. Leveraging Netstock for BOM management and capacity planning
Netstock’s advanced software integrates multi-level BOM data, enabling better production scheduling and capacity planning.
It can consolidate complex BOM structures to accurate material forecasting, ensuring components delivery to the production is at the right time and place. Component visibility reduces lead times, prevents bottlenecks, and supports better procurement.
Netstock addresses the core needs of supply chain professionals with features like:
- Optimized stock levels: Netstock balances and optimizes inventory levels, so your business can meet demand without risking excess stock or stockouts.
- Real-time data synchronization: Netstock can integrate BOM data with your current inventory management system, providing real-time data about stock availability and production requirements.
- Enhanced forecasting: Accurate forecasts based on BOM data mean you can plan material and production better than before.
Netstock’s BOM lets you view all levels, from raw materials to subassemblies.
8. Simplifying production with multi-level BOMs
Managing multi-level BOMs effectively can make production run smoother and give better visibility across the supply chain. Teams can easily handle complex product structures, and having one central source of information helps different departments work together and reduce errors.
 
			



